The New $5 bill and the Old Gas Pumps

Gary's post about the new $5 bill reminded me of a story I read yesterday. It seems that some of the old gas stations are living in fear of $4.00 per gallon gas. The reason is that lots of the old, pre-digital gas pumps can't handle anything more than $3.99 per gallon on their pricing mechanisms. I imagine that way back when they were building these things and gas was twenty cents per gallon, buying gas for $2.99 seemed like a flight of fancy. And yes, I said $2.99 not $3.99. Many of these pumps have already been upgraded once.
